s7与变频器用CP341通过modbus RTU通讯。发送数据用modbus功能码6,接收数据用modbus功能码4。频率给定上位机用32位浮点数。变频器的频率接收16进制数。我用MOVE把上位机给定的频率往变频器发送数据块(DB)中的寄存器值中送,DB块中的数据一直不变。哪个环节出了问题。怎么处理一下。谢谢
最佳答案
参考,CP340/CP341/CP440/CP441通讯及编程,https://support.industry.siemens.com/cs/document/72928033
串口通信模块的信息与使用,链接:https://support.industry.siemens.com/cs/document/79684826
由上位机发送数据给DB,你的DB打开调用?
提问者对于答案的评价:
谢谢
原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c206169.html